Knox County Career Center vs. ICASI
Both Knox County Career Center and International Culinary Arts and Sciences Institute are Less than 2 years schools located in Ohio. The following statements compare Knox County Career Center and International Culinary Arts and Sciences Institute with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
- ICASI's tuition ($24,615) is more expensive than Knox County Career Center ($17,672).
- ICASI's students to faculty ratio (3 to 1) is lower than Knox County Career Center (4 to 1).
- Knox County Career Center (126 students) is larger than ICASI (33 students) with more enrolled students.
- ICASI ($4,733) has higher amount of financial aid than Knox County Career Center ($3,303).
- Knox County Career Center's graduation rate (100%) is higher than ICASI (48%).
